Learn Basic Italian
Italian Greetings, Goodbyes + Introductions
Ciao – Hello / Goodbye
Buongiorno – Good morning / Good day
Arrivederci – Goodbye
Buonanotte – Good night
Mi chiamo _______. – My name is __________. / I am called __________.

Learn Basic German
German Greetings, Goodbyes + Introductions
Hallo – Hello
Guten Morgen – Good morning
Guten Tag – Good day / Good afternoon
Auf Wiedersehen – Goodbye
Gute nacht – Good night
Ich bin _______. – I am __________.
